Ratings Comparison
| Metric | Twin Oaks Elementary | Richland Elementary |
|---|---|---|
| Overall Rating | 4.5 / 10 | 7.4 / 10 |
| Academic Score | 6.9 | 8.8 |
| Growth Score | 2.7 | 7.8 |
| Diversity Index | — | — |
| Free/Reduced Lunch | 46.7% | 32.2% |
| Environment Score | 5.2 | 4.3 |
| State Rank | #8,009 of 9,539 | #2,815 of 9,539 |
| State Percentile | 16th | 71th |
Test Scores
| Subject | Twin Oaks Elementary | Richland Elementary |
|---|---|---|
| Math Proficiency | 74.0% | 76.0% |
| Math (State Avg) | — | — |
| ELA Proficiency | 69.0% | 65.0% |
| ELA (State Avg) | — | — |
School Details
| Detail | Twin Oaks Elementary | Richland Elementary |
|---|---|---|
| Type | Elementary School | Elementary School |
| Grades | Kindergarten – 5th | Kindergarten – 5th |
| Enrollment | 706 | 869 |
| Student-Teacher Ratio | 22.8:1 | 24.8:1 |
| Free/Reduced Lunch | 46.7% | 32.2% |
| Chronic Absenteeism (SY 2022-23) | 23.2% | 17.4% |
| District | San Marcos Unified | San Marcos Unified |
| City | San Marcos | San Marcos |
